C++ 齿轮问题解法:静态数组实现 - GearsDiv2
#include
using namespace std;
int main() { int n; cin >> n;
char gears[50];
cin >> gears;
int count = 0;
for (int i = 0; i < n; i++) {
if (gears[i] == 'L' && gears[(i+1)%n] == 'R') {
count++;
}
else if (gears[i] == 'R' && gears[(i+1)%n] == 'L') {
count++;
}
}
cout << count << endl;
return 0;
}
原文地址: https://www.cveoy.top/t/topic/qxeF 著作权归作者所有。请勿转载和采集!